ABOUT THE ROLE: We are looking for a Senior Data Scientist to join our Compliance Program and play a pivotal role in modernizing and strengthening our financial crime detection capabilities. You will architect, build, and optimize data-driven transaction monitoring models, coverage assessment frameworks, and advanced analytics solutions that directly support BSA/AML regulatory compliance, including but not limited to SAR filing, Customer Identification Program elements, and Enhanced Due Diligence measures. The role will also support the OFAC Sanctions, Fraud and overall risk prioritization across multiple products and jurisdictions. This is a high-impact, cross-functional role that blends advanced analytics, machine learning, and deep compliance domain expertise. You will work closely with Compliance, Engineering, Model Risk, Product, and external regulators to ensure our controls are robust, defensible, and scalable. RESPONSIBILITIES: Design, develop, and enhance AML and fraud models, rules, and heuristics using Python, SQL, and AI-enabled tooling; partner with the Compliance Machine Learning team on model reviews to improve detection rates and reduce false positives. Build and maintain interactive performance dashboards and automated reporting solutions that track key risk, productivity, and capacity metrics for senior leadership and regulators. Architect and implement enterprise-wide Transaction Monitoring Coverage Assessment frameworks, including standardized methodologies for gap identification, root-cause analysis, remediation planning, and ongoing sustainability monitoring. Lead complex data initiatives, including extraction of SAR filing metrics with product-level breakdowns and development of jurisdiction- and typology-specific SAR narrative generator tools. Embed data science best practices into product launches and feature rollouts to proactively identify and close monitoring coverage gaps. Support regulatory examinations (e.g., NYDFS Part 504) by preparing analytical documentation, third-party validation materials, and executive certification packages. Drive continuous improvement of compliance operations through automation, process optimization, and advanced analytics. BASIC QUALIFICATIONS: 7+ years of hands-on data science / advanced analytics experience in financial services, with at least 4 years focused on fraud and financial crime compliance .
